For sale – a chain-free two bedroom terraced house tucked away just off Tor Hill Road in central Torquay.
Neutrally decorated throughout, this cosy home offers a bright front reception room with fitted storage and an open staircase, providing a comfortable main living space. To the rear is a generous kitchen with a good range of wall and base units, contrasting worktops and space for appliances, plus room for a family dining table – ideal for everyday living and entertaining.
Upstairs are two well-proportioned bedrooms, both enjoying good natural light and simple décor, ready for a new owner to personalise. The bathroom is on the ground floor and features a white suite with panelled bath, pedestal basin and WC, finished with light wall coverings and recessed spotlights.
Set in a small pedestrian lane, the house benefits from a more secluded feel while still being moments from Torquay town centre. Everyday amenities, supermarkets and the shops and cafés of the high street are all within easy reach, with Torquay seafront and harbour offering waterside walks, bars and restaurants.
Torquay railway station provides direct services to Exeter (around 45 minutes) and Plymouth (approximately 50 minutes), connecting onwards to London and the wider rail network. Local bus routes along Tor Hill Road and nearby main roads give convenient access around the Bay, including Paignton and Brixham.
This well-located two bedroom terraced house offers a practical layout and neutral finish, making it an attractive option for first-time buyers or investors seeking a central Torquay home.
